How to Manually Remove tags.bluekai.com Redirect Virus


1. Stop running processes related to this redirect virus.
a: When the Windows Task manager appears, switch to Processes tab.
b: Find out and select the processes related to the virus by name random.exe, and click on the “End process” button.
Remove the redirect virus from Internet Explorer:
a: Start IE, go to Tools and select Internet Options.
b: Find General section, remove tags.bluekai.com address as a home page.
c: Then go to Search section, find Settings button and choose Manage Add-ons
d: Erase the redirect and after the action, close Manage Add-ons

2. Remove the redirect virus from Mozilla Firefox.
a: Open Mozilla Firefox browser, click on tools and go to Options.
b: Switch to General tab, remove tags.bluekai.com address as a startup site.
c: Then, go to: Firefox -> Add-ons -> Add-ons Manager -> Remove.
d: In the Search list, select Manage Search Engines and erase this redirect and choose OK

3. Remove the redirect virus from Google Chrome.
a: Open Google Chrome and navigate to Settings tab and Set pages.
b: Erase tags.bluekai.com which was seta as the startup site and choose OK
c: Find Manage search engines and here, erase this redirect.
d: Press on OK, and restart Google Chrome.
